Understanding The Ins And Outs Of Family Law Law

Family law is a legal practice area that focuses on issues involving family relationships, such as divorce, child custody, adoption, and domestic violence. family law law, therefore, encompasses the rules and regulations that govern these matters and protect the rights of individuals involved in familial disputes.

family law law covers a wide range of issues, with some of the most common areas including:

1. Divorce: Divorce is the legal process by which a marriage is dissolved. family law law dictates the procedures and requirements for filing for divorce, as well as addressing issues such as property division, spousal support, and child custody.

2. Child Custody: Child custody arrangements determine which parent has legal or physical custody of a child. Family law law provides guidelines for determining custody arrangements that are in the best interests of the child, as well as enforcement mechanisms to ensure that custody orders are followed.

3. Adoption: Adoption is the legal process by which a person assumes the parental rights and responsibilities of a child. Family law law regulates the adoption process, ensuring that prospective parents meet certain requirements and that the best interests of the child are taken into consideration.

4. Domestic Violence: Domestic violence refers to abusive behavior within a household or intimate relationship. Family law law includes provisions for obtaining protective orders against abusive individuals and holding perpetrators accountable for their actions.

5. Paternity: Paternity issues arise when the identity of a child’s biological father is in question. Family law law addresses paternity disputes, including establishing or challenging paternity through DNA testing and determining parental rights and responsibilities.
